James Earl Lewis, 87, a resident of Culleoka, TN, died Friday, November 21, 2025 at NHC HealthCare Oakwood in Lewisburg.

Funeral services will be conducted Monday, November 24, 2025 at 2:00 PM at Oakes & Nichols Funeral Home with Brother Luke Beagly officiating. Burial will follow in Friendship Cemetery with military honors provided by Herbert Griffin American Legion Post 19. Visitation will be from 12:00 noon until 2:00 PM Monday at the funeral home. Online condolences may be extended at www.oakesandnichols.com.

He was born on July 3, 1938 in Memphis, TN to the late Thomas Sidney “T.S.” Lewis and the late Hester Gertrude Neagle Roberts. He served two years in the United States Navy, stationed at Treasure Island, San Francisco, California. James had many interests over the years; loved fishing, an avid reader of Louis L’Amour novels, woodworking, gardening, lawn care, painting, drawing, outdoors, and tending to goats and chickens. He was of the Baptist faith and was a song leader in many churches over the years.

Survivors include his wife of 65 years, Stella Fleming Lewis of Culleoka; two sons, James B. Lewis (Cindy) of Walker, Louisiana and Charlie D. Lewis (Vickie) of Culleoka; seven grandchildren, Heather Baker (Wesley), Christopher Vise, Neil Vise, Melanie Stewart (Shawn), Wendy Harvey (Tyler), Amanda Green, and Coty Davis (Keishia); two sisters in law, Dorothy Phillips (Reg) of Grand Prairie, Texas and Pat Fleming of New Smyrna, Florida; several great grandchildren and great great grandchildren; and many nieces and nephews.

In addition to his parents, he was preceded in death by his siblings Charles, Harold, Jane, Kathleen, and Florence.

Family and friends will serve as pallbearers. The family would like to express a special thank you to the staff of NHC HealthCare Oakwood and Caris Healthcare for their care.
